I haven't found any previous posts on this book, but I apologize in advance if I'm repeating old info.
I bought this book a few weeks ago after Cryptic started their build-up to Season 7 and introducing the VESTA-class. I wanted to fill-in the background information on the new ship and other random elements of STO. It's also the first Star Trek book I've read in about 20yrs.
I was impressed by the scope of the book (it's one volume that combines all three books in the Gods of Night trilogy). It's an easy read, moves along at a good pace, includes a lot of familiar characters from TNG, DS9 and VOYAGER, develops the story of the Borg well beyond the more canon sources, and seems to fit in well with the more traditional Star Trek stories from the movies and TV series.
I highly recommend it for anyone interested in filling in some of the background information in STO, or looking for some time to kill.
